Vintage 8mm home movie footage from Florida USA in 1959, showing a distant ship navigating the high seas. The clip is framed by dark borders, with visible film grain, slight color fading, and a muted palette typical of mid-century amateur film. The ocean stretches to the horizon under an overcast sky, with gentle waves rolling toward the shore. A large vessel, possibly a cargo or passenger ship, appears on the horizon, moving steadily across the water. The footage captures a quiet, contemplative moment of maritime travel, evoking a sense of nostalgia and historical observation.
